Vinous (91-93)(totally destemmed; the crop level was just 23 hectoliters per hectare but there was little frost damage here, according to Gublin): Deep red with ruby tones. Deeper, more important nose hints at medicinal dark cherry and spices. A big step up in concentration over the basic Santenots, conveying an almost chocolatey ripeness and terrific density to its kirsch, spice and savory mineral flavors. This fruit was picked four days later than the younger Santenots vines and the wine delivers much more complexity and grip. Shows a relaxed quality that belies the low yield. Excellent balance and potential here. |

Wine Advocate (99)The most harmonious wine of the six lieux-dits this year—and one of the finest renditions of this cuvée—is the 2018-based NV Ambonnay Le Bout du Clos, disgorged in February 2025 without dosage. The wine unfurls from the glass with a deep bouquet of orange oil, dried flowers, lychee and Sichuan pepper, mingled with kumquat and almond paste. On the palate, it is full-bodied and precise, with an elegantly muscular core of fruit, uniting the typical depth of complexity attained in this bottling with ample structuring extract that provides a vivid sense of freshness. Simultaneously grandiose and racy, it is driven by a bright spine of acidity and culminates in a long, searingly saline finish. Multifaceted and complete, it encapsulates everything that is so compelling about the Selosse lieux-dits. As ever, it derives from two south-facing parcels within the same lieu-dit that are characterized by clay-rich soils, and it is composed of approximately 80% Pinot Noir and 20% Chardonnay, which are picked and pressed together. The historic blend dates back to 2002. |

Vinous - Antonio Galloni (98)The NV (2019) Extra-Brut Le Mesnil-sur-Oger Les Carelles is another magnificent wine in this range of Blanc de Blancs lieux-dits from Selosse. It offers some of the solar intensity of Cramant and the vertical structure of Avize. The 2019 is opulent and very rich, but not at all heavy. Orange confit, spice, tangerine oil, spice, menthol, passion fruit and a kiss of French oak stain the palate. Not drinking this requires an almost inhuman amount of discipline. Dosage is 1.2 grams per liter. Disgorged: February 12, 2026 |

Wine Advocate (97)Whereas Selosse's vintage bottling was formerly derived exclusively from Avize, the 2007 Extra-Brut Millésime is the first that draws on all the estate's holdings, with the vins clairs chosen in a blind tasting. Wafting from the glass with aromas of yellow apple, toasted almonds, nougat, shortbread, warm spices, honeycomb and white flowers, it's full-bodied, layered and multidimensional, with incisive acids, chalky structure and a tensile profile. A bottle drunk in Burgundy several weeks after my visit to the domaine was just as striking. |
